Another match with many goals. :) It was quite difficult to observe I must say because both teams had kits with similar colors. :P

Fortunately our wingers were given pretty much space this time as Australia hadn't covered the wings just as I had suspected. On the other hand, our two midfielders got pretty much beaten by more Australians and maybe against a stronger side it could have ended up worse for us.

1 Virgimantas Synanovičius 5/10
I would have expected a bit more. The Australians' second goal could have been avoided as the shot was made from such a difficult angle and Virgimantas seemed to have covered the goal-line.

2 Linksmutis Stupokas 7/10
I was satisfied with his performance, especially when taking into account he played full 90 mins despite having tragic stamina.

3 Jefimovas Užolas 8/10
The heart of our defense, as usual. Made a solid performance as we could have conceded more considering how empty our midfield was.

4 Rimandas Jaseliūnas 8/10
Worked well alongside his partner in central defense, wasn't weaker than him in any way. Managed to cope with the opponents extremely well after the red card of Kuniskis.

5 Meilutis Kuniskis 5/10
Several fouls and a red card - I can't be happy. Although our defense didn't seem to suffer much due to his absence, he gave the opponents a few dangerous free kicks.

6 Mironas Vuičekas 8/10
He was stopped several times by the opponent defenders, but he still gave an assist and some more great passes into the box.

(46' Slavekas Liutvaitis 7/10
He performed slightly worse than Mironas in my opinion. At leats he got an assist too in the end, but his passes were more inaccurate.

7 Vjačeslavas Šniaukas 7/10
I have to credit him for playing the whole match in our dodgy midfield as his stamina is not very high either. He made nice passes throughout the match, helping both the strikers and the wingers. Seemed to be lacking pace a bit though.

8 Kazemiras Naskauskas 7/10
He has similar skills to his partner Vjačeslavas and I think he played up to his abilities. Made a bit more defensive work which was important.

(46' Rafikas Geisleris) 8/10
One of our young stars. Definitely played a great match, giving one assist and producing many great passes. I can't honour him with a larger mark though because he only played one half. :)

9 Simeonas Žlobas 9/10
One of the best today. He was especially active in the second half - his opponent wing-back failed most of the times in stealing the ball from him. He created many dangerous passes besides the one assist.

10 Virgas Vainušis 7/10
He wasn't too bad, even had one close situation when his shot inside the box was saved by Deeley. I believe one day he will score too. :)

(46' Vytas Alencevičius) 7/10
Nothing really special either. Scored one from a Liutvaitis assist but was quite invisible most of the time, probably because of his low form. However. he will definitely be fighting with Rudis Martinkėnas for the spot when they are both fit.

11 Prakofijus Rabinovičius 9/10
A brilliant game again. This time he let the others score one too and settled with a hat-trick only instead of five goals, but I'm still glad. :) He had more goal chances but he scored just as much as needed.
